About Spoken Reasons

SPOKEN REASONS has created a massive name for himself as a multi-talented individual. From spoken word, poetry, music and short films, it is no question as to why he is one of today’s biggest entertainers. With nearly over 200M views and 2M YouTube subscribers, 300K followers on Twitter and 900K likes on Facebook, he has a loyal following both on and off the web.

Growing up in Bradenton, Florida he first discovered his passion for sharing his thoughts on stage by witnessing spoken word poetry online. Bit by the poetry bug, he began developing his own style and following, but it didn’t stop there. Realizing the impact that the internet had on his life, he decided to use it as a tool to spread his thoughts and messages globally by putting that energy into his music and performing for his large college fan base including at some of the top universities to date: Howard University, Penn State University, University of Texas - Austin, Syracuse and many more. He penned the name “Spoken Reasons” because he realized the true power of words, stating, “Everything that comes out of your mouth has a living with purpose.”

The next chapter of his life began in 2011 when he worked with Grammy Award-Winning Mogul, 50-Cent. Spoken then landed a role in the 2013 “funniest comedy of the year” The Heat along with Sandra Bullock and Melissa McCarthey and later appeared on Kevin Hart’s The Real Husbands of Hollywood in 2014. His success drew the attention in the media with with The Breakfast Club, Snoop Dogg’s GGN Series, and was named one of Forbes "30 under 30 in Hollywood".

In between writing scripts for his YouTube videos and short films, being on and off sets, recording music or doing tours - Spoken drew the attention of Russell Simmon’s and was named the Brand Ambassador for the business magnate’s new YouTube network, All Def Digital.

Spoken’s success has always been influenced by his mantra, FCHW: Faith, Consistency, and Hard Work, which has turned into a movement among his fans, and will continue to live that mantra for the many things he has planned for his future.
